Metadata Sub-indicator 1.3.1.2. Proportion of persons with disabilities receiving benefits

Goal

Goal 1. End poverty in all its forms everywhere

Target

Target 1.3. Implement nationally appropriate social protection systems and measures for all, including floors, and by 2030 achieve substantial coverage of the poor and the vulnerable

Indicator

Indicator 1.3.1. Proportion of population covered by social protection floors/systems, by sex, distinguishing children, unemployed persons, older persons, persons with disabilities, pregnant women, newborns, work-injury victims and the poor and the vulnerable

Sub-indicator

Sub-indicator 1.3.1.2. Proportion of persons with disabilities receiving benefits

Type of indicator (global, European, national)
Global
Definition

Persons with disabilities receiving a benefit as a proportion of the total number of persons with disabilities (greater than or equal to 33 per cent)

Calculation method

\[ PPD^t_{prestación} = \frac{PD^t_{prestación}}{PD^t}\cdot 100\]

Where: PDtprestaciónis the number of persons with disabilities receiving a benefit in year t and PDt is the total number of persons with disabilities (disability greater than or equal to 33 per cent) in year t.

Unit of measure

Percentage

Observations

The number of people with disabilities receiving a benefit includes people with a disability of a degree greater than or equal to 65% and who receive a contributory, non-contributory or assistance pension or one of the so-called economic benefits for people with disabilities.
